Allow NYC office workers to work remotely
COVID-19 showed what a powerful tool teleworking is for the resilience & wellbeing of NYC. Through it, NY continued working and providing services to our customers and stakeholders while strengthening local communities.
My proposal is to allow City office workers to telework three days a week.
Telework creates a workforce that allows NYC to meet any challenge. It is good for work-life balance & mental health, and reduces congestion on crowded subways.

Municipal employees already showed during the height of the pandemic that we can work successfully from home. Mayor Adam's supported this concept when he was seeking our Union votes 🗳 during the Democratic primary.
When we work at home 🏡 we support our local economies. We have to pivot as we are losing talent from all city agencies to the private sector. We can reduce our office footprint and repurpose those buildings to deal with the homeless crisis we have in NYC. We can consolidate field offices and make those offices we use in a neighborhood style office space where you come in only when we have to gather for certain office tasks.
